Search engine optimization (SEO) is the process of improving your website and its content so that search engines find and rank them higher on search results. It’s one of the most effective organic marketing methods and if done right, can take your law firm right to where people are looking for your services. 

The benefits of SEO for law firms cannot be overstated. When your content is visible to relevant searches, your legal site gets more traffic, engagement, and ultimately, some of the visitors turn into clients. 

So, how do you optimize your law firm’s online presence for search engines? Here are a few places to start:

Website Optimization

A lot of technical factors in your website will determine how visible your law firm is to potential clients. 

First, the total loading time has to be relatively fast or visitors will abandon your site and probably never come back. With such a high bounce rate, search engines might start ranking more useful and faster sites higher than yours.

Second, optimize your site’s functionality so that it displays seamlessly on different screen resolutions like desktops and mobile phones. Your law firm’s website design should also provide a smooth user experience from things like colors, buttons, transitions, and so on. 

Keyword Research

Potential clients use specific words and phrases to search for your legal services, known as keywords. These are what you should integrate into your content as naturally as possible. 

Start by researching the most popular keywords in your industry and then narrow down to the specific legal services that you offer. Use this information on your website copy or blog posts.

Remember to research for local keywords as well. Since a majority of your clients will come from your local area, optimizing your content for local search will ensure that they find you faster.

Content That Offers Value

Even with the right keywords and a well-designed website, the value of your content is what determines how long potential clients stay. 

People click on your site because they are looking for specific information. Valuable content means that you answer their questions in the best way possible.

If you are displaying a landing page, the content should answer things like what you do, values you believe in, previous cases you have won, and how potential customers can find you. For blog posts and articles, research the main problems that your audience is experiencing and offer solutions.

Include Your Social Media

Besides a website, law firms should also have at least one social media profile. It’s effective for brand exposure and increased website traffic. 

Social media can contribute to your SEO efforts in several ways. It offers an ideal platform for you to share website content that might be useful to your audience such as blog posts. Another way is by appearing in results for branded searches. If you are providing valuable content, your followers are likely to share it in other places as well. This increases your overall website traffic and engagement from potential clients.

When this happens, search engines mark your site as useful and are likely to display it among the top search results. 

Legal Directories

An online directory is like a catalog or database with information about people or businesses. A legal directory contains data about law firms, including the name, physical address, phone number, operating hours, website address if any, and even images of the premises. 

Claiming your listing on a legal directory is especially effective for local SEO. The location-specific information required by online directories enables search engines to match your content with the right local searches.
